About this service

Springs are the heavy-duty components that counterbalance the weight of your garage door. They are under high tension and will eventually wear out or snap after thousands of cycles. If your door feels extremely heavy, won't lift, or makes a loud bang, you likely have a broken spring. Replacing them requires specialized tools for safety. What are the benefits of a wall mount garage door opener?

Wall mount garage door openers, also known as jackshaft openers, offer a sleek, space-saving solution. They mount directly to the torsion spring shaft, freeing up ceiling space. This is ideal for garages with low ceilings or obstructions. They are also typically quieter than traditional openers. Licensed pros can install these for a clean, modern look.
